Draping For Profit
by
Rich and Esther Beitzel
When something
slightly different is added to a tried and true process, it's
referred to as giving it a new "wrinkle."
We hope to give your photography a new wrinkle by showing you
various ways to drape your backdrops.
This program will
revolve around hanging and draping tricot fabric and muslin
backdrops. Gathering
fabric and clamping it at just the right spot can add a lot of
dimension to your existing backdrops.
The effect of lighting will also be discussed as it plays a
huge part in how the draping looks.
Using power point
and demonstrations, this program will fly by as we cram as much
information into 1.5 hours as we can.
Our goal is to give you usable concepts that will add variety
to your existing backdrops.
